Hey everyone, new to the forum. I bought OEM bed lights for my 2019 Ram 2500 Laramie. Followed the instructions running the wires and connecting to the BCM. Instructions say plug DG/WT wire into C6 pin#26 (which has no wire but also has no male prong on the BCM when I pull the connector), and C1 pin#5 which has an existing tan wire with orange tracer. After days of research I can’t find anythingsaying different, so I went ahead and and plugged the DG/WT in C6 pin#26 and spliced the second wire to C1 pin#5. Well as long as the truck is on the lights are on and when the truck is off they turn off. Neither of the switches, the bed switch and cargo lamp button affect the bed lights. They just stay on.

Saying all that, I know the pins used are wrong. Does anyone have info on the correct pins to use?

Got the wiring diagram from the dealer today and looks like the 2018 C6 pin 26 (Cargo lamp switch signal on circuit L26) is the equivalent to my 2019’s C7 pin 16. And then the 2018 C1 pin 5 (Cargo lamp driver on circuit L19) is the equivalent to my 2019’s C3 pin 17. Can anyone look at the snapshots of the wiring attached and confirm that I’m not just looking at this completely wrong?
